    Samruk-Kazyna Share Placement Worth $1.4 Billion Sparks Speculation Over Transfer of State’s 40% ERG Stake

    Kazakhstan’s sovereign wealth fund Samruk-Kazyna has announced the placement of 31 of its own shares at 22.5 billion tenge each — a total of 697.7 billion tenge, equivalent to approximately $1.4 billion — in exchange for unspecified state property, sparking speculation that the transaction may involve the government’s 40% stake in Eurasian Resources Group currently held by the Ministry of Finance’s Committee on State Property and Privatisation.

    The fund’s sole shareholder, the Kazakhstani government, holds the pre-emptive right to purchase the shares. The announcement did not identify the state property being transferred, but the scale of the transaction — $1.4 billion — prompted financial analyst Arman Bataev of the Finmentor Telegram channel to suggest the asset in question is the government’s ERG stake, given that it is the most significant state-held mining asset at a comparable valuation.

    The timing adds to the intrigue. On 23 May, ERG announced a major ownership change: Nature Energy Solutions Ltd., owned by Kazakhstani businessman Shakhmurat Mutalip, acquired a combined 39.3% stake from Patokh Chodiev (18.6%) and the heirs of Alexander Machkevitch (20.7%). The Financial Times had previously reported that the transaction value was approximately $1.4 billion — precisely matching the sum now involved in the Samruk-Kazyna share placement.

    If the analysis is correct, the current ERG ownership structure would be: the Ministry of Finance holding 40%, the Ibragimov family 20.7%, and Nature Energy Solutions — Mutalip’s vehicle — 39.3%. A transfer of the Ministry of Finance’s 40% stake to Samruk-Kazyna would consolidate state control of ERG within the sovereign fund structure rather than the government’s direct balance sheet.

    ERG is one of Kazakhstan’s most strategically significant industrial conglomerates, producing ferroalloys, copper, cobalt, aluminium and gallium across operations in Kazakhstan, Africa and beyond.

    The Ground-Level Reality of Kazakhstan Mining Finance

    East Star Resources CEO Alex Walker presented to investors with the kind of frankness that rarely makes it into official mining forums. His central message: the Verkhuba copper deposit in Kazakhstan is now funded to production, with Chinese EPCM powerhouse Xinhai taking 70% in exchange for carrying all development costs — an estimated US$65 million — to first copper.

    East Star retains 30%, fully carried, with no debt obligation. Xinhai gains majority only when it has delivered US$50 million worth of equipment to site. Until that moment, East Star holds control.

    “You do not get majority until you have sunk way more money into this,” Walker tells his audience.

    It is a deal structure worth understanding carefully, because it illuminates something important about how junior miners are actually navigating the Kazakhstan opportunity in 2026 — and it is a long way from the headline-grabbing announcements coming out of this week’s official forums.

    The Xinhai model — a Chinese EPCM contractor taking equity in exchange for funded development — is not new. But its scale and pace are accelerating. Xinhai now claims over 2,500 projects delivered globally, with more than US$42 million committed to ASX and LSE-listed companies for feasibility and construction in 2025 alone. They manufacture their own processing equipment, manage their own supply chains, and have demonstrated the ability to build a 1.5 million tonne per annum processing plant in Kazakhstan in under twelve months.

    Walker is characteristically direct about the implications: “I visited their factory in Yantai. They make everything — the rubber liners that go in your crushing plants. That means you are not reliant on where you sit in a queue for your equipment provider. You manage your entire supply chain.” When Xinhai told him they thought they could deliver Verkhuba within a compressed timeline, he said, he believed them.

    For a junior miner navigating the gap between resource and production — the graveyard of so many promising projects — this kind of vertically integrated partner is genuinely transformational. Walker is blunt about which risks he had effectively eliminated: financing, capex blowouts, and timing. Three of the five classic killers of junior development projects, struck off in a single deal.

     

    The Copper Market Context Nobody Is Ignoring

    Walker touched on the macro backdrop, referencing a conversation with senior Goldman Sachs mining analysts about the copper deficit forming in the rest-of-world, non-US market. The figures are striking. Goldman Sachs now projects a deficit of over 640,000 tonnes in ex-US copper markets in 2026 — a number revised sharply upward from a prior estimate of just 60,000 tonnes, driven largely by US front-loading of copper imports ahead of potential tariffs. J.P. Morgan adds a 330,000-tonne deficit projection of its own, while even the historically conservative International Copper Study Group has swung from forecasting a 209,000-tonne surplus in late 2025 to a 150,000-tonne deficit by May 2026.

    The convergence of major institutional forecasters on a significant 2026 deficit is the backdrop against which Walker’s geopolitical point lands hardest. Copper from the DRC loaded onto a ship can be diverted mid-voyage to capture a premium on the COMEX in New York. Copper that travels by rail from Kazakhstan cannot. Its destination is fixed. In a world where tariffs and trade route disruption are rewriting commodity flows in real time, Kazakhstan’s landlocked geography – once a liability – is becoming a structural advantage for certain end markets, particularly China. The supply cannot be diverted. It simply arrives.

     

    The Questions Investors Are Actually Asking

    The sharpest exchanges of the meeting came during questions. One investor raised the spectre familiar to anyone who has backed a junior miner in a joint venture with a larger partner: what stops the big partner from simply putting the project on ice when it suits them?

    Walker’s answer was layered. First, the deal structure itself: Xinhai only achieves majority when equipment worth US$50 million has been delivered to site. If they walk away before that, East Star keeps its majority and a significant amount of delivered capital. “They’d be selling US$50 million worth of equipment and still getting a good return on capital,” he noted. “So we’ll figure out how to build it ourselves.”

    Second, he made a pointed commercial observation: Xinhai wants East Star to be their business development partner in Kazakhstan, bringing them more deals. Betraying a partner publicly would destroy that franchise. “The first group they screw over — that business model is shut,” he said. “That’s why I don’t think they’d do it.”

    A second question probed the structure of East Star’s 30% retained interest more sharply: does the company actually own 30% of the project, or is it simply entitled to 30% of the copper? And crucially, who controls the surplus capital once the mine is producing?

    Walker confirmed that East Star owns 30% of the project entity, with marketing rights for approximately 30% of production. On dividend distribution, he was direct: under the shareholders’ agreement with Xinhai, dividend policy is a reserved matter requiring mutual agreement — the majority shareholder cannot unilaterally determine how cash is deployed. “Dividend distribution is one of those matters that needs a vote from both sides,” he said. Whether the cash ultimately flows back to shareholders or is redeployed into new projects — perhaps towards building a 300,000-ounce-per-year gold mine with Endeavour — is a question for later. The structural protection, he argued, is real.

    AI and the New Exploration Toolkit

    One detail from the evening deserves particular attention, and it speaks to how the competitive landscape for junior miners in Kazakhstan is changing.

    East Star’s porphyry gold exploration programme — the Snowy and Piket licences on the Balkash-Ili magmatic arc — was initially funded through a grant from the BHP Xplor programme, which Walker described as “a highly competitive programme: 600 applicants, 6 accepted.” The programme is explicitly oriented around applying advanced analytical techniques — including AI-driven target generation — to early-stage exploration. East Star’s selection is a mark of technical credibility that carries weight with institutional investors.

    The broader context matters here. Kazakhstan’s government has been investing heavily in the digitalisation of its geological archive — over 97% of primary geological information, approximately 250 terabytes of data, has now been scanned and consolidated into a unified system. An AI-powered platform has been developed to automatically process this archive, extract coordinates, and generate subsurface geological models. Officials describe the technology as significantly reducing data processing time and improving the quality of exploration decisions.

    For companies like East Star, operating across some of Kazakhstan’s most prospective but underexplored belts, this convergence of digitised state geological data and AI-assisted targeting represents a genuine step-change in the speed and cost of identifying drill-ready targets. The question of where the next Nikolskoye or Verkhuba might be hiding is increasingly one that algorithms, not just geologists, are helping to answer.

     

    The Regulatory Picture: Nuance Required

    One of the most interesting questions of the meeting came from an investor who had been tracking changes to Kazakhstan’s mining regulatory framework. The question concerned a reported increase in the threshold for mandatory government approval of ownership changes in mining companies, and the role of the national mining company Tau-Ken Samruk in new joint ventures.

    The regulatory picture here is genuinely nuanced, and worth examining carefully.

    Kazakhstan’s December 2025 amendments to the Subsoil and Subsoil Use Code were primarily aimed at digitalisation, transparency, and strengthening strategic investor incentives. Separately, amendments signed by President Tokayev also tightened state control in the uranium sector specifically, raising certain transfer thresholds and granting Kazatomprom priority rights over uranium exploration licences.

    As for Tau-Ken Samruk — the state’s national mining company and a subsidiary of the sovereign wealth fund Samruk-Kazyna — Chambers and Partners’ 2026 Kazakhstan Mining guide notes that the government is actively seeking to restore Tau-Ken Samruk’s priority rights for obtaining exploration and mining licences for critical minerals, a right that had previously been removed as part of earlier liberalisation efforts. “We expect this priority right to be restored in 2026,” the guide notes, describing it as a deliberate effort to increase the state’s foothold in the early stages of the critical minerals supply chain.

    The direction of travel is clear, even if the precise mechanics are still being finalised: Kazakhstan is simultaneously offering incentives to attract international capital and tightening state participation rights in the assets that matter most. For investors in junior miners operating here, this duality is not a contradiction — it is the operating environment. Understanding it, and structuring agreements, accordingly, is the price of entry.

    The Endeavour JV: A Different Model, Same Logic

    East Star’s joint venture with Endeavour Mining – a US$25 million exploration programme with one of the world’s top ten gold producers – follows a different but structurally similar logic. Endeavour funds exploration through to pre-feasibility study, earning up to 80% along the way. East Star manages the JV until Endeavour reaches 51% and is carried through to PFS completion.

    Again: no dilution beyond agreed thresholds, no unilateral majority until capital milestones are met, and a world-class operator bearing the exploration and development risk.

    Walker’s reference point is Independence Group in Western Australia — a company that held a minority in what became the Tropicana gold project with AngloGold, eventually building that stake into hundreds of millions of dollars of annual cash flow. The analogy is instructive: the value is not in owning the whole mine. It is in owning the right percentage of the right mine, with the right partner, under the right agreement.

    Walker put it simply: “If we have 20% of something that Endeavour is building, even with financing, that’s a billion-dollar company for just East’s percentage. That’s something I’m really excited to maintain.”

    This philosophy is increasingly evident among the better-managed junior miners operating in Central Asia. The era of the go-it-alone junior – raising capital dilutively on the back of exploration results, lurching from drill hole to drill hole – is giving way to something more sophisticated: structured, partner-funded development with clear milestone-based governance.

    US Envoy Gor Tells Astana C5+1 Dialogue Washington Is Changing Its Approach to Central Asia: “This Is Where We Want to Work”

    The United States opened a new round of high-level critical minerals talks with all five Central Asian governments in Astana on 10 June, with US Special Envoy for South and Central Asian Affairs Sergio Gor delivering a pointed message that Washington has decided to significantly deepen its engagement with a region it acknowledges has not received the attention it deserves.

    “We care about this region, we want to be involved with this region, we want to identify win-win situations for the United States and your nations,” Gor told the first in-person C5+1 Critical Minerals Dialogue, held at The Ritz-Carlton in Astana and attended by officials from Kazakhstan, Kyrgyzstan, Tajikistan, Turkmenistan and Uzbekistan. The session covered geological exploration, surveying and mapping, mining and processing, and global value and supply chains.

    Gor said the Trump administration’s increased focus on Central Asia reflects a clear strategic calculation. “There’s a reason we’re sitting at this table and not at another table around the world. It’s because this is where we have identified trusted partners,” he said. He pointed to the US International Development Finance Corporation as a key instrument, saying it was preparing to invest in critical minerals, telecommunications and Trans-Caspian infrastructure, and saw potential to transform the region’s mineral deposits into “the foundation of a new wave of industrialisation.” He added that Washington stands behind American companies operating in the region: “There is no such thing as a deal too small.”

    Kazakhstan’s Industry and Construction Minister Yersaiyn Nagassayev framed the dialogue as a continuation of the bilateral track opened during President Tokayev’s November 2025 visit to Washington, when a critical minerals memorandum of understanding was signed in Tokayev’s presence by Nagassayev and US Commerce Secretary Howard Lutnick. He cited the Cove Capital tungsten cooperation — involving the Northern Katpar and Upper Kairakty deposits in Karaganda Region — as a concrete follow-up to those agreements.

    Nagassayev presented Kazakhstan’s case for deeper partnership on multiple dimensions. The country holds more than 9,500 mineral deposits, including over 100 containing rare and rare earth metals. Investment in geological exploration has tripled since 2018 to exceed $1 billion annually, and the country has adopted the CRIRSCO international reporting standards since 2024. Major international companies including Rio Tinto, Barrick Gold, First Quantum, Ivanhoe, Teck, Fortescue and Cove Capital have entered the market.

    Crucially, Nagassayev emphasised that Kazakhstan seeks to be a value-added partner rather than a raw material exporter. “Kazakhstan is interested not only in exporting raw materials, but also in developing joint production facilities, technology transfer, workforce training, and scientific cooperation,” he said, proposing cooperation in processing, industrial clusters, advanced materials and research centres. He also linked the critical minerals agenda to the Middle Corridor transport route as a mechanism for diversifying Eurasian connectivity and ensuring reliable supply chain flows.

    Gor met President Tokayev shortly before the dialogue session, and Kazakhstan’s Foreign Ministry said the bilateral talks with Foreign Minister Yermek Kosherbayev covered economic partnerships, innovation, artificial intelligence, education, transport, logistics and the implementation of Tokayev-Trump agreements from November 2025.

    Japan and Kazakhstan Launch EAGLE-4 Fast Reactor Safety Programme as Tokyo Advances Generation IV Nuclear Development Towards 2050

    Japan’s Atomic Energy Agency and Kazakhstan’s National Nuclear Centre have signed a memorandum of cooperation to undertake a fourth phase of the EAGLE project — a long-running joint research programme on core safety experiments for sodium-cooled fast reactors — marking a new chapter in nuclear technology collaboration between the two countries.

    NNC RK Director General Erlan Batyrbekov and JAEA President Masanori Koguchi signed the agreement, which initiates the EAGLE-4 project covering several in-pile experiments at NNC RK’s IGR research reactor, twelve out-of-pile experiments at the EAGLE test bench, and a series of small-scale tests. The main objectives are to test fuel assemblies for advanced Japanese Generation IV reactors, conduct research at NNC RK facilities, and provide a scientific basis for safety assessment of advanced nuclear technologies. NNC RK is in discussions with JAEA on extending the project through to 2031.

    The EAGLE programme began in the early 2000s and has now completed three phases. Across those phases, approximately 200 preparatory tests, two intermediate-scale and nine full-scale reactor experiments, and more than 65 out-of-pile tests were carried out, collectively confirming that molten fuel is promptly discharged from a reactor core in the event of a severe accident — a key safety finding for the development of next-generation sodium-cooled fast reactor technology.

    The programme sits within Japan’s broader strategic effort to revive fast reactor development after a prolonged pause. Japan’s government decommissioned the Monju sodium-cooled fast reactor in 2016 following a series of technical problems, including a sodium coolant leak in 1995. A strategic roadmap adopted by the Cabinet in 2018 and revised in 2022 selected sodium-cooled fast reactors as the target for a demonstration reactor conceptual design, with a demonstration fast reactor planned for operation by 2050.

    Fast neutron reactors offer substantially more efficient use of uranium resources than conventional power reactors and can burn actinides — characteristics that make them attractive for long-term energy security and waste management. For Kazakhstan, the EAGLE collaboration provides both scientific engagement and a demonstration of the country’s growing role as a partner in advanced nuclear research, complementing its dominant position as the world’s largest uranium producer.

    Kazakhstan Emerges as Central Asia’s Critical Minerals Powerhouse as Uranium, Tungsten and Rare Earths Drive Global Investor Interest

    Kazakhstan is undergoing a fundamental repositioning in global resource markets, moving from a country primarily associated with oil, gas and bulk commodities to one increasingly recognised as a strategic supplier of uranium, rare earth elements, tungsten and other critical minerals essential to advanced manufacturing, defence systems and the energy transition.

    Three themes dominated Central Asian mining capital markets over the past week: strategic developments at Kazatomprom, shifting ownership dynamics at Eurasian Resources Group, and US government-backed financing for Kazakhstan’s tungsten projects.

    Kazatomprom, the world’s largest uranium producer, reinforced investor confidence by announcing the partial redemption of $100 million in long-term bonds — a signal of balance sheet strength during one of the strongest uranium markets in decades. The company’s market value has grown to approximately $19 billion, more than six times its IPO valuation, as nuclear energy regains strategic favour across Europe, North America and Asia. Management expects production growth in 2026 while maintaining a disciplined approach that prioritises value creation over aggressive volume expansion. State ownership through Samruk-Kazyna remains an important factor for investors assessing long-term strategic direction.

    ERG, one of the world’s largest producers of ferroalloys, iron ore, aluminium, copper and cobalt, attracted attention following ownership changes involving a significant stake. Investors interpreted the development as part of a broader trend toward greater government influence over strategically important mining assets — a pattern that extends beyond corporate governance given ERG’s critical minerals portfolio. The group previously accounted for approximately 20% of global gallium production, a metal classified as strategic by both the US and EU for its applications in semiconductors, telecommunications equipment and advanced electronics. ERG’s growing importance to global resource security has elevated it from a traditional mining group to a company viewed as critical infrastructure within global supply chains.

    On the tungsten front, a company developing the Northern Katpar and Upper Kairakty deposits — among the largest tungsten developments outside China — has reportedly sought an additional $400 million in US government-backed financing, supplementing previous expressions of interest valued at up to $1.6 billion. The scale of international backing reflects how strategic mineral projects are increasingly evaluated through a national security lens rather than as conventional commodity investments.

    Both Kazakhstan and Uzbekistan are pursuing policies designed to move beyond raw material exports, attracting investment in processing, refining and downstream industrial operations to capture a greater share of the value chain domestically. This strategic shift mirrors approaches seen in other resource-rich regions seeking long-term economic resilience, and creates new investment opportunities across multiple segments of the mining and industrial ecosystem.

    C5+1 Critical Minerals Dialogue Convenes in Astana Ahead of AMM-2026 Congress as Kazakhstan Highlights 9,500-Deposit Resource Base

    A C5+1 Critical Minerals Dialogue was held in Astana on the eve of the 16th Astana Mining and Metallurgy Congress, co-chaired by Kazakhstan’s Minister of Industry and Construction Yersaiyn Nagassayev and US Special Envoy for South and Central Asia Sergio Gor, bringing together government representatives from Kyrgyzstan, Tajikistan, Turkmenistan and Uzbekistan alongside the United States.

    Discussions focused on priority areas of cooperation between Central Asian states and the US across the full critical minerals value chain — geological exploration, extraction, processing and supply to global markets. Participants identified long-term cooperation directions including the development of high-technology processing industries, creation of industrial clusters, technology transfer, workforce training and strengthened scientific and technical cooperation. Logistics and supply chain reliability for delivering products to world markets also featured prominently in the agenda.

    Minister Nagassayev emphasised Kazakhstan’s position at the centre of the format’s mineral security agenda. “President Tokayev particularly underscores the important role of the C5+1 platform as a new format of interaction between Central Asia and the United States. The C5+1 Critical Minerals Dialogue is aimed at deepening cooperation in sustainable strategic raw material supply, developing technological interaction and building reliable global supply chains,” he said. He described Kazakhstan’s critical minerals sector as one of the country’s industrial policy priorities, noting that the country’s resource base encompasses more than 9,500 deposits, over 100 of which contain rare and rare earth metals. Digitalisation measures and the adoption of international standards have driven a significant increase in investment, attracting major global companies including Rio Tinto, Barrick Gold, First Quantum, Ivanhoe, Teck, Fortescue and Cove Capital.

    All parties confirmed their interest in developing multilateral cooperation and implementing joint industrial and infrastructure projects.

    Rasta Resources to Begin Gold-Silver Exploration Across Six Licence Areas in Kazakhstan’s Karaganda Region

    Rasta Resources has announced plans to conduct geological exploration for gold and silver across six licence areas in the Aktogay District of Karaganda Region, with work scheduled to begin in the second quarter of 2026 and conclude in the fourth quarter of 2031.

    The company received its exploration licence on 4 October 2025. The total licensed area covers 12 square kilometres, with the nearest inhabited settlement — the village of Koshkar — located more than 14 kilometres to the southeast. The exploration programme includes 21.4 linear kilometres of geological survey routes, topographic work across 1.69 square kilometres, and geophysical electrical survey work over two square kilometres. Mining works will involve the excavation of 2,000 cubic metres of trenches and the drilling of 30 exploration boreholes totalling 3,000 linear metres. Some 5,000 samples will be collected for gold analysis and other laboratory work, with the programme concluding in a geological report and reserve calculation under C1 and C2 categories.

    Rasta Resources is registered in Almaty and is owned by AIFC-registered private company SD Resources Group Ltd and Almas Rakhymbayev. SD Resources Group is co-owned by Danagul Adamyshina and Suzanna Toktabayeva. Public registry data shows that Adamyshina is listed as director of at least seven companies registered at the same Almaty address, including White Peak, Metanor Resources, Noctung Resources, Quantum Minerals, Altynkol Resources and Terrasouth Resources.

    The ownership structure carries notable background. Ten years ago, Adamyshina headed the subsoil use analysis and development department at Kazakhstan’s Ministry of Investment and Development — the predecessor to the current Ministry of Industry and Construction — and was actively involved in drafting the future Subsoil Code. Her co-owner Suzanna Toktabayeva shares a surname with Timur Toktabayev, who served as director of the subsoil use department and later as deputy minister at the same ministry before being convicted in 2023 and sentenced to seven years in prison. The director of OTSD Group Ltd, another company in the network, is listed as Olzhas Toktabayev.

    Kazakh Scientists Develop Near Zero-Waste Technology for Processing Complex Polymetallic Ores

    Specialists from Kazakhstan’s National Center for Integrated Processing of Mineral Raw Materials have developed and successfully tested an advanced technology for processing complex polymetallic ores from the Shalkiya and Zhairem deposits.

    According to Kazakhstan’s Ministry of Industry and Construction, traditional mineral processing methods remain highly inefficient, with up to 90–95% of processed material ending up as waste while valuable components are lost. The newly developed technology is designed to maximize raw material utilization and significantly reduce tailings volumes.

    The key innovation lies in the carbothermic processing of lead-zinc ores with high silicon content using ore-thermal furnaces. Under conventional processing schemes, silica is discarded into tailings storage facilities. The new method instead converts silica into marketable ferroalloys, while lead and zinc transition into the gas phase for subsequent concentration and extraction.

    Pilot-industrial testing was conducted using furnaces with capacities ranging from 80 to 630 kVA. The process produced:

    • Ferrosilicon grades FS45, FS65 and FS75

    • Ferrosilicoaluminum

    • Aluminosilicomanganese

    • New calcium- and magnesium-containing ferroalloys

    Researchers also focused on processing lead-zinc sublimates. As a result, they obtained:

    • High-purity zinc (grade TsV0)

    • Magnesium compounds

    • Tribasic lead sulfate

    • Advanced composite electrochemical coatings with high corrosion resistance

    The developers describe the project’s main achievement as the creation of an almost waste-free processing scheme. Unlike conventional methods, where silicon is entirely lost in enrichment tailings, the new technology converts it into commercial products. More than 99% of lead and zinc are transferred into concentrated form.

    The research team has secured more than 10 patents covering the new solutions for difficult-to-process ores. Technical specifications have also been prepared for designing ferroalloy production facilities and complexes for processing sublimates. Preliminary calculations indicate that product value generated per unit of cost could more than double compared with existing processing technologies.

    Kazakhstan’s Revised Subsoil Code Threatens CGN Mining’s Uranium Stakes as Contract Renewals Loom

    Chinese uranium company CGN Mining is closely studying amendments to Kazakhstan’s Subsoil and Subsoil Use Code adopted in December 2025, which could significantly alter the ownership structure of its joint ventures with Kazatomprom when existing licences come up for renewal — potentially stripping the company of a substantial portion of its uranium resource base within four to five years.

    Under the updated Code, Kazatomprom can claim up to a 90% stake in uranium projects at the point of contract renewal, unless the foreign joint venture partner applies an option to transfer uranium conversion and enrichment technology. The Chinese side possesses such technology, which provides a theoretical negotiating lever. The legislation also increased Kazatomprom’s mandatory participation in new uranium ventures transitioning from exploration to production from 50% to 75%.

    CGN Mining holds 49% stakes in two joint ventures with Kazatomprom. In Semizbay-U — acquired for $133 million in 2014 — the company holds subsoil rights to the Semizbay deposit in Akmola Region, with a licence valid until 2031, and the Irkol mine in Kyzylorda Region, valid until 2030. JORC-compliant reserves and resources at year-end 2025 stood at 4,600 tonnes at Semizbay and 1,800 tonnes at Irkol. In 2025, the joint venture produced 862 tonnes of uranium against a plan of 861 tonnes — 397 tonnes from Semizbay at a production cost of $37 per pound U3O8 and 465 tonnes from Irkol at $31 per pound. CGN received nearly $33 million in after-tax dividends from Semizbay-U in 2025.

    At current extraction rates, the Semizbay deposit’s reserves would take more than ten years to exhaust — well beyond the contract’s expiry. This creates a clear risk: upon renewal, Kazatomprom could claim 90% of the project, leaving CGN with a dramatically reduced position. Irkol’s reserves may be depletable before contract expiry, but additional resources estimated under Kazakhstan’s State Reserve Commission standard leave uncertainty.

    The second asset, Ortalyk — acquired for $435 million in 2021 — operates two mines in Turkestan Region: the Central Mynkuduk block with a licence until 2033 and Zhalpak until 2042. Combined reserves and resources stood at approximately 30,000 tonnes of uranium at end-2025. Ortalyk produced 1,834 tonnes of uranium in 2025 after processing losses, generating $64.7 million in after-tax dividends for CGN. At current rates, the Central Mynkuduk block cannot be fully depleted before its 2033 contract expiry — requiring approximately ten years at current output — meaning a portion of its resources could transition to Kazatomprom upon renewal. Zhalpak, with its 2042 deadline, offers a realistic chance of full utilisation if annual output increases to around 1,000 tonnes.

    The broader context involves significant mutual dependence. China typically accounts for approximately half of all Kazatomprom’s uranium sales, making Kazakhstan an indispensable supplier for China’s expanding nuclear power programme. In May, Kazakhstan’s Senate ratified a bilateral investment protection agreement with China, and Chinese officials pointed to extensive international arbitration opportunities in Hong Kong for Kazakhstani companies — signals that both sides are laying legal groundwork ahead of what may be complex renegotiations.

    Central Asia Metals Acquires Canada’s Cygnus Metals for $166 Million to Add Quebec Copper-Gold Project to Kazakhstan and North Macedonia Portfolio

    London-listed Central Asia Metals has agreed to acquire Canadian explorer Cygnus Metals for approximately A$232 million ($166 million) in an all-share deal, adding the Chibougamau copper-gold project in Quebec to a portfolio that already includes producing operations in Kazakhstan and North Macedonia.

    Under the terms of the agreement, CAML will issue 0.06 new shares for each Cygnus share, valuing each Cygnus share at A$0.176 — a 60% premium to the last closing price and a 40% premium to the 20-day volume-weighted average. Following completion, existing CAML shareholders will retain approximately 70% of the combined company, with Cygnus shareholders holding the remaining 30%. A Cygnus shareholder vote requiring 75% approval is expected in September, and CAML will hold its own shareholder meeting to approve the share issuance. CAML also intends to seek a listing on the Toronto Stock Exchange or TSX Venture Exchange to broaden its North American investor base.

    Chibougamau, located in central Quebec approximately 480 kilometres from Montreal and acquired by Cygnus in 2024, hosts indicated resources of approximately 149,000 tonnes of copper and 167,000 ounces of gold, alongside inferred resources of 182,000 tonnes of copper and 454,000 ounces of gold, based on a 2022 preliminary economic assessment by previous owner Doré Copper Mining. The site includes existing infrastructure and a historic copper processing plant with 900,000 tonne per year capacity. CAML plans to advance a full feasibility study using its own underground mining expertise.

    CAML’s existing operations — the Sasa zinc-lead underground mine in North Macedonia and the Kounrad copper heap leach operation in central Kazakhstan — are expected to produce 12,000 to 13,000 tonnes of copper cathode, 18,000 to 20,000 tonnes of zinc concentrate and 26,000 to 28,000 tonnes of lead concentrate in 2026. The Chibougamau acquisition follows CAML’s unsuccessful attempt last year to acquire Australia’s New World Resources and its Arizona copper project.

    Non-executive chairman Nick Clarke described Chibougamau as a high-quality copper-gold asset that fits well alongside CAML’s existing operations and provides a clear path to near-term growth. Cygnus also holds lithium exploration assets in Quebec’s world-class James Bay region and rare earth and base metal projects in Western Australia.
